Navigating the process of reaching a personal injury settlement can be complex. There are various alternatives available to you, each with its own benefits and cons. It's essential to understand these possibilities so you can make an intelligent decision that addresses your unique needs.

One common option is to bargain a settlement directly with the at-fault party's insurance copyright. This can often be a quicker route, but it requires careful consideration and competent assistance.

On the other hand, you may choose to submit a lawsuit in court. This option enables you to obtain a larger settlement, but it can be a more drawn-out and costly procedure.

It's highly recommended to engage an experienced personal injury legal professional who can advise you through the resolution process and help you identify the best path forward for your circumstances.

Factors Affecting Personal Injury Settlement Amounts

Determining the amount of a personal injury settlement can be a complex process influenced by numerous factors. The severity of the injuries sustained plays a crucial role, with more serious damages typically leading to higher settlements. Elements like medical expenses, lost wages, and pain with suffering all contribute to the overall payment. The liability of the party involved is another key factor, as cases involving clear negligence often result in larger settlements. The location in which the case is filed can also influence settlement amounts due to variations in policies. Finally, circumstances such as the strength of the evidence presented and the ability of the legal representation may influence the final settlement result.

Understanding The Legal Process of a Personal Injury Settlement

A personal injury settlement demands a complex legal process. First, an injured party must secure the services of an experienced personal injury lawyer to champion their rights. The lawyer will investigate the occurrence, gather documentation and determine the extent of the damages.

Afterward, a written proposal is presented to the at-fault party's provider. Negotiations will frequently ensue between the lawyer and the adjuster to reach a mutually acceptable settlement.

In case negotiations fail, the case may proceed to litigation, involving a trial.
